免费看操逼电影1_99r这里只有精品12_久久久.n_日本护士高潮小说_无码良品_av在线1…_国产精品亚洲系列久久_色檀色AV导航_操逼操 亚洲_看在线黄色AV_A级无码乱伦黑料专区国产_高清极品嫩模喷水a片_超碰18禁_监国产盗摄视频在线观看_国产淑女操逼网站

weex 開發(fā)的app應(yīng)用

解鎖跨平臺(tái)開發(fā)新范式:Weex構(gòu)建高性能App的實(shí)戰(zhàn)指南

移動(dòng)應(yīng)用開發(fā)領(lǐng)域長(zhǎng)期面臨一個(gè)核心矛盾:??如何平衡開發(fā)效率與原生性能???傳統(tǒng)Hybrid方案因性能瓶頸飽受詬病,而純?cè)_發(fā)又面臨雙端代碼重復(fù)的難題。2025年的今天,阿里巴巴開源的Weex框架通過??Vue.js語法+原生渲染??的獨(dú)特架構(gòu),正在重新定義跨平臺(tái)開發(fā)的邊界。


為什么Weex成為企業(yè)級(jí)開發(fā)的新寵?

??性能與效率的黃金平衡點(diǎn)??是Weex最顯著的標(biāo)簽。與React Native相比,Weex的渲染管線直接對(duì)接原生組件樹,省去了JavaScript橋接的層級(jí)調(diào)用開銷。實(shí)測(cè)數(shù)據(jù)顯示,Weex在Android低端機(jī)上的列表滾動(dòng)幀率比傳統(tǒng)Hybrid方案提升300%。

更值得關(guān)注的是其??開發(fā)體驗(yàn)的革命??:

  • 支持熱重載(Hot Reload)實(shí)現(xiàn)秒級(jí)界面更新
  • 復(fù)用Vue.js的響應(yīng)式數(shù)據(jù)綁定和單文件組件規(guī)范
  • 內(nèi)置Flexbox布局系統(tǒng),告別平臺(tái)差異化的適配噩夢(mèng)

某電商App的實(shí)踐案例表明,采用Weex后其活動(dòng)頁(yè)面的開發(fā)周期從2周縮短至3天,且iOS/Android的UI一致性達(dá)到98%。


從零搭建Weex開發(fā)環(huán)境:2025最新實(shí)踐

??環(huán)境配置是成功的第一步??。根據(jù)2025年Android Studio的最新特性,推薦以下配置流程:

  1. ??基礎(chǔ)工具鏈安裝??

    需確保Node.js版本≥16.x,Android SDK Platform API等級(jí)≥31。

  2. ??項(xiàng)目初始化技巧??
    使用weex create時(shí)添加--type=webpack參數(shù)啟用Tree Shaking,可減少30%的打包體積。新建項(xiàng)目的目錄結(jié)構(gòu)應(yīng)包含:

  3. ??Android集成關(guān)鍵步驟??
    build.gradle中聲明SDK依賴時(shí),建議鎖定版本號(hào)避免兼容性問題:

    同時(shí)需要在AndroidManifest.xml中配置WXApplication的子類作為Application。


組件化開發(fā):Weex UI的進(jìn)階之道

??Weex UI組件庫(kù)??是提升開發(fā)效率的核武器。最新版的Weex UI 2.0支持??按需加載??和??主題定制??,例如實(shí)現(xiàn)一個(gè)帶漸變色按鈕的彈窗只需:

性能優(yōu)化方面需特別注意:

  • ??列表渲染??:優(yōu)先使用而非,其虛擬滾動(dòng)機(jī)制可使萬級(jí)數(shù)據(jù)列表內(nèi)存占用降低80%
  • ??圖片加載??:通過的lazy-load屬性實(shí)現(xiàn)視窗動(dòng)態(tài)加載
  • ??組件拆分??:?jiǎn)蝹€(gè).vue文件建議不超過300行,復(fù)雜邏輯應(yīng)拆分為子組件

性能調(diào)優(yōu):從理論到實(shí)戰(zhàn)的跨越

??Bundle加載優(yōu)化??是首屏速度的關(guān)鍵。2025年主流方案包括:

  1. ??預(yù)加載策略??:在App啟動(dòng)時(shí)靜默下載后續(xù)頁(yè)面的JS Bundle
  2. ??骨架屏技術(shù)??:通過組件保持視覺連續(xù)性
  3. ??代碼分割??:利用Webpack的Dynamic Import實(shí)現(xiàn)路由級(jí)按需加載

??內(nèi)存管理??的典型陷阱包括:

  • 避免在中嵌套超過3層的組件結(jié)構(gòu)
  • 及時(shí)銷毀setInterval等定時(shí)器
  • 使用weex.requireModule('memory')監(jiān)控內(nèi)存水位

某社交App通過上述優(yōu)化,其Weex頁(yè)面的Crash率從1.2%降至0.05%。


原生能力擴(kuò)展:突破Web的限制

通過??Module擴(kuò)展機(jī)制??,Weex可實(shí)現(xiàn)與原生功能的深度集成。例如開發(fā)一個(gè)藍(lán)牙模塊的步驟:

  1. 繼承WXModule編寫Java類
  2. 使用@JSMethod注解暴露方法
  3. 前端通過weex.requireModule('bluetooth')調(diào)用

更創(chuàng)新的應(yīng)用場(chǎng)景如:

  • ??AR視圖??:將ARKit/ARCore封裝為Weex組件
  • ??AI推理??:集成TensorFlow Lite實(shí)現(xiàn)端側(cè)智能
  • ??硬件加速??:通過OpenGL ES渲染復(fù)雜動(dòng)畫

這些擴(kuò)展使得Weex在IoT、智能家居等新興領(lǐng)域展現(xiàn)出獨(dú)特優(yōu)勢(shì)。


隨著Flutter的熱度消退,Weex憑借??更低的遷移成本??和??更成熟的Vue生態(tài)??正在收復(fù)失地。2025年GitHub數(shù)據(jù)顯示,Weex的中國(guó)企業(yè)用戶同比增長(zhǎng)40%,其中金融、電商行業(yè)占比達(dá)67%。未來,隨著WebAssembly技術(shù)的融合,Weex有望實(shí)現(xiàn)??毫秒級(jí)冷啟動(dòng)??的突破——這或許將是跨平臺(tái)框架的下一座里程碑。


本文原地址:http://m.czyjwy.com/news/136730.html
本站文章均來自互聯(lián)網(wǎng),僅供學(xué)習(xí)參考,如有侵犯您的版權(quán),請(qǐng)郵箱聯(lián)系我們刪除!
上一篇:weex 開發(fā)框架 app
下一篇:weex 開發(fā)的app